[發明專利]基于數據共享平臺實現對啟動調度服務加載計劃的優化處理的系統及其方法在審
| 申請號: | 201910674999.0 | 申請日: | 2019-07-25 |
| 公開(公告)號: | CN110377368A | 公開(公告)日: | 2019-10-25 |
| 發明(設計)人: | 徐明明;劉相;顧偉 | 申請(專利權)人: | 普元信息技術股份有限公司 |
| 主分類號: | G06F9/445 | 分類號: | G06F9/445;G06F9/48 |
| 代理公司: | 上海智信專利代理有限公司 31002 | 代理人: | 王潔;鄭暄 |
| 地址: | 201203 上海市浦東新區中*** | 國省代碼: | 上海;31 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 數據共享平臺 服務加載 啟動調度 優化處理 頻度 錯誤數據 配置模塊 過濾 優化 資源目錄管理 作業調度引擎 可用性 調度引擎 服務啟動 計劃模塊 計劃作業 計算調度 設置模塊 設置信息 使用數據 數據資產 在線作業 整個平臺 正常啟動 數據源 觸發 加載 可用 服務 | ||
1.一種基于數據共享平臺實現對啟動調度服務加載計劃進行優化處理的系統,其特征在于,所述的系統包括:
在線作業配置模塊,用于根據資源目錄管理數據源,并完成單作業信息;
頻度設置模塊,與所述的在線作業配置模塊相連接,用于增加頻度設置信息;
計劃作業配置模塊,與所述的頻度設置模塊相連接,用于關聯作業和頻度、日歷及時間窗信息;
優化帶有頻度計劃模塊,與所述的計劃作業配置模塊相連接,用于計算調度觸發時間列表并進行優化,過濾錯誤數據;
調度引擎服務啟動模塊,與所述的優化帶有頻度計劃模塊相連接,用于啟動調度引擎,剔除或修改錯誤數據。
2.根據權利要求1所述的基于數據共享平臺實現對啟動調度服務加載計劃進行優化處理的系統,其特征在于,所述的在線作業配置模塊的數據源為在源、前置區、共享區、消費方配置的數據源。
3.根據權利要求1所述的基于數據共享平臺實現對啟動調度服務加載計劃進行優化處理的系統,其特征在于,所述的在線作業配置模塊的信息包括作業名稱、別名、模板、代理服務器、作業服務器、作業描述、表或文件映射、源字段和目標字段映射關系。
4.根據權利要求1所述的基于數據共享平臺實現對啟動調度服務加載計劃進行優化處理的系統,其特征在于,所述的頻度設置模塊增加的信息包括名稱、別名、頻度類型、起始日期、描述和間隔時間。
5.根據權利要求1所述的基于數據共享平臺實現對啟動調度服務加載計劃進行優化處理的系統,其特征在于,所述的計劃作業配置模塊關聯的信息包括名稱、別名、頻度類型、日歷、作業、激活時間、運行時間窗起始和運行時間窗結束。
6.一種利用權利要求1所述的系統實現基于數據共享平臺對啟動調度服務加載計劃進行優化處理的方法,其特征在于,所述的方法包括以下步驟:
(1)所述的在線作業配置模塊配置數據源,并完成單作業信息;
(2)所述的頻度設置模塊增加頻度信息;
(3)所述的計劃作業配置模塊關聯單作業與頻度、日歷及時間窗信息;
(4)所述的優化帶有頻度計劃模塊根據計算的作業觸發時間校驗計算出觸發時間;
(5)所述的調度引擎服務啟動模塊啟動調度引擎,剔除或修改錯誤數據。
7.根據權利要求3所述的實現基于數據共享平臺對啟動調度服務加載計劃進行優化處理的方法,其特征在于,所述的步驟(4)具體包括以下步驟:
(4.1)所述的優化帶有頻度計劃模塊根據計劃關聯的頻度和日歷計算計劃作業的觸發時間計算時間;
(4.2)所述的優化帶有頻度計劃模塊判斷計算的時間是否為正值且大于最后一次計算出的時間,如果是,則是正確數據,繼續步驟(4.3);否則,剔除錯誤數據,打印日志,加載下一個計劃,繼續步驟(4.1),直至計劃加載完成。
8.根據權利要求3所述的實現基于數據共享平臺對啟動調度服務加載計劃進行優化處理的方法,其特征在于,所述的步驟(5)具體包括以下步驟:
(5.1)所述的調度引擎服務啟動模塊正常啟動服務,使狀態可用,并查看日志;
(5.2)判斷是否有錯誤數據,如果是,則手動修改或去除錯誤數據,重新啟動,直至沒有錯誤計劃作業的數據日志;否則,正常啟動,結束流程。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于普元信息技術股份有限公司,未經普元信息技術股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201910674999.0/1.html,轉載請聲明來源鉆瓜專利網。





